20110117391 | BATTERY PACK - Provided is a battery pack formed by coupling a cover case and a bare cell. The battery pack includes: a bare cell including a cap plate having a surface in which at least one screw receiving groove is formed; a cover case disposed at a side of the cap plate, and having a surface in which at least one mounting groove is formed and a hole penetrating a center of the mounting groove; and at least one tapping screw including a head part and a body part that are mounted in the mounting groove of the cover case, wherein the body part penetrates the hole and is coupled to the screw receiving groove of the cap plate; wherein the cap plate includes a protruding unit formed in the second surface of the cap plate in correspondence to the screw receiving groove of the cap plate. | 05-19-2011 |
20110123837 | BATTERY PACK - The battery pack comprises: a bare cell including a can, wherein the can includes an opening on one side, and a cap plate sealing the opening of the can, wherein the cap plate has at least one groove formed on one surface; a circuit board including at least one lead tab. wherein the lead tab is coupled to the cap plate by a fixing body; and a coupling member coupled with the fixing body in the groove. The coupling member and the bare cell are made of different materials. Therefore, in the battery pack, the internal resistance between the bare cell and the protective circuit board does not increase, or the cover case is not separated when an external shock is applied. | 05-26-2011 |
20120015217 | POLYMER BATTERY PACK AND MET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ING THE SAME - A polymer battery pack includes a core pack having a protective circuit module attached to a bare cell, a case having the core pack coupled thereto, the protective circuit module having a portion exposed to an exterior of the case, and a resin enclosing at least a portion of the protective circuit module that is exposed to the exterior of the case. A method of manufacturing a polymer battery pack includes forming a bare cell, forming a core pack having a protective circuit module, coupling the core pack to an interior of the case such that the protective circuit module is exposed to an exterior of the case, and molding the protective circuit module with a resin such that a terminal on the protective circuit module is exposed to an exterior of the resin. | 01-19-2012 |

20140333251 | EXTERNAL BATTERY - An external battery includes an input end, an output end, a bare cell between the input end and the output end, a charging unit configured to deliver power from a charger to the bare cell via the input end, a first switch between the charging unit and the input end, a DC-DC converter configured to convert an output voltage from the bare cell into a converted voltage of a magnitude that is different from that of the output voltage, and configured to deliver the converted voltage to the output end, a second switch between the bare cell and the DC-DC converter, and a main controller unit (MCU) configured to sense at least one of overcharging, over-discharging, or an over-discharge current of the bare cell using the output voltage or an output current from the bare cell, and configured to control the first switch and the second switch. | 11-13-2014 |
